Intraop video of Dr Erik D.Peterson repairing a PASTA tear with knotless anchor technique

by Erik D.Peterson, MD | 14 years ago

Here is a new technique that Dr Peterson presents for knotless, trans-tendon repair of a supraspinatous PASTA tear (Partial Articular-Sided Tendon Avulsion). The technique utilizes a 4.5 helacoil anchor and one 4.5 footprint anchor. The approach is straight forward and quick.
